Summary: Aaron Swartz, a coder, activist, and open-access advocate, took his own life on 11 January 2013. He will be remembered for his participation in numerous projects that have played a significant role in the evolution of the Internet.<p> </p><p>Read the <a href="http://tidbits.com/article/13496">full article at TidBITS</a>, the oldest continuously published technology publication on the Internet.
